NN14 6DN lies on John Smith Avenue in Rothwell, Kettering. NN14 6DN is located in the Rothwell and Mawsley electoral ward, within the unitary authority of North Northamptonshire and the English Parliamentary constituency of Kettering.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Northamptonshire ICB - 78H and the police force is Northamptonshire. This postcode has been in use since August 1993.
